Regular Season Round 12: TuSLi Berlin - Wolfenbuettel 68-66

Date: December 16, 2017
Rather predictable result when second ranked TuSLi Berlin (8-2) edged 6th ranked Wolfpack Wolfenbuettel (5-5) in Lichterfelde 68-66 on Saturday. However just two-point win is not that big difference and the fans of host team counted on more convincing victory. The hosts took control from the first minutes by winning first half. But Wolfpack Wolfenbuettel won third quarter 13-9. However it was not enough to take a lead and get a victory that evening. Strangely Wolfpack Wolfenbuettel outrebounded TuSLi Berlin 48-29 including a 20-5 advantage in offensive rebounds. It was a good game for power forward Nyara Sabally (-0) who led her team to a victory with a double-double by scoring 22 points and 11 rebounds. International swingman Ireti Amojo (176-90, college: Washington St.) contributed with 9 points for the winners. TuSLi Berlin's coach Alexandra Maerz used entire bench in such tough game. American forward Brianna Rollerson (183-94, college: Creighton) replied with a double-double by scoring 23 points and 24 rebounds and Canadian guard Nakeshia Hyde (180-90, college: Texas Tech) added 26 points and 10 rebounds in the effort for Wolfpack Wolfenbuettel. TuSLi Berlin have a solid three-game winning streak. They maintain second position in North with 8-2 record behind leader Freiburg. Loser Wolfpack Wolfenbuettel keeps the sixth place with five games lost. TuSLi Berlin will have a break next round. Wolfpack Wolfenbuettel will play at home against B.Loewen (#10) and hope to win that game.
